Wurst Dash is a lighthearted endless runner game where players control a sausage navigating through a series of dangerous traps across various environments. While the game sports a humorous aesthetic on the surface, the actual gameplay is quite intense; a split-second delay in your reactions can result in the sausage being sliced in half, crushed, or instantly roasted to a crisp.
The game offers a variety of modes to choose from. If you want to get a feel for the controls, you can start with Single Player mode. Meanwhile, Survival mode is better suited for those who enjoy testing their reflexes and seeing just how long they can last. Additionally, there is a Multiplayer mode that allows you to play with friends or other players online. In Survival mode, the game currently features three maps—Kitchen, Garden, and Beach—each with a unique trap layout and pace of movement, ensuring the gameplay never feels too repetitive.
The game utilizes a fairly simple control scheme. The sausage moves forward automatically, while the player's primary task is to time their acceleration and deceleration to successfully clear obstacles. Pressing the Up arrow key causes the sausage to curl up and speed forward—a crucial maneuver for dodging the various types of traps found throughout the game.
The longer you play, the denser the obstacles become, requiring increasingly faster reaction times. While the game's rules are easy to grasp, making it far requires you to gradually familiarize yourself with the specific timing and mechanics of each different trap type.
